"Please stay strong and take care of yourself," the clique members were all hugging him tightly before leaving the school building, only Hoseok had stormed outside without sparing anyone a glance.

He hasn't said a word since Jungkook has met him yesterday, maybe still in a too big shock after the news of his best friend's death, but it was Jungkook who has lost it all, his world, his light, his beloved boyfriend.

"In case you need anything just call we will come to keep you company," his friends were worried, all assuring they're here for him when the last thing Jungkook needed was pity.

"It's ok, I'll handle," he muttered wishing for them to disappear quickly.

They were still turning around for many times so he was faking a painful grin waving his hand robotically.

The main square in front of the school became quiet as they have been the last leaving when a car engine broke the silence, a police car was approaching. Jungkook placed his hands in the pants pocket of his school uniform walking downstairs, but the car stopped right in front of him.
The man who came out was the same detective who has brought him the news about Jimin death two days ago.

"Do you have a moment to talk?" he asked opening a small notebook.

"I'm going home," Jungkook's voice was sharp, of course he meant that total chaos of the dormitory room, the only roof above his head, as it has been the scholarship money paying for his tuition, as some people believed he had some talent.

"It won't take long," the detective was watching him as if he indeed was guilty of something.

"Did Jimin have any enemies? Has he been bullied or threatened by someone?"

The question crumbled the hair on Jungkook's head.

"Everyone adored Jimin, why are you asking nonsense like that?"

The man was looking him straight into the eyes as if trying to read some hidden truth out of them.

"There have been fingerprints found on Jimin's body," he said when Jungkook felt as if someone has punched all the air out of his lungs.

"What do you mean?" His voice cracked.

"Boy, just breath and think harder, who has had a motive? Who has hated Jimin so much?"

Jungkook shook his head, there was really no one he could think of, everyone loved Jimin, he was the private sun of their clique.

"There's no one I can think of," he whispered.

"Ok, if something comes to your mind, here's my card, contact me immediately."

Jungkook took the card hesitantly watching the man retuning to the police car.

"Detective," something came to his mind so he ran towards the car. "Who's fingerprints have you found?"

The detective's face seemed to have aged in seconds.

"We're still investigating the case, but... the fingerprints belong to Jung Hoseok."

"What?" Jungkook was watching the detective unable to understand, he might have heard something wrongly, right?

"The evidence in indistinguishable so far, so we are still collecting information. Please contact me in case anything comes to your mind," the detective nodded getting into the car to leave.

Jungkook was standing there frozen, shuttered to the core.

Hoseok has been Jimin's best friend for years, how could he.

The images of Hoseok as if embarrassed, hiding behind Jimin's parents at the funeral, not saying a thing to any of them since Jimin's death, leaving the ceremony first were coming back in speed. Jungkook's fists closed, his mid blurred out by pure fury and hate.

His steps were rushed on his way back to the dormitory. The pieces of the broken mirror still scrunching under his leather shoes when he came in. The room had been a total mess, as he had demolished everything he could get into his hands at the first outburst. Jungkook ignored, changing quickly into his usual black oversized clothes, covering his head with a hood before going downstairs to the basement kitchen.

A boy was cooking some late dinner but Jungkook pretended he is looking for some bowls and chopsticks, his heart beating like crazy when his fingers closed on the knife the boys have been using to filet fish for sashimi. The other boy hasn't ever noticed what he has carried outside, back to his room to use a stone he had found along the ocean when Jimin had taken him for a beautiful weekend down south in the country, when there had been just the two of them, nothing but love, pleasure and serenity, not like now, a boy sharpening a knife along the stone, hiding it in his pocket to cast his scattered mirror reflection one last glance, his eyes carrying death.

There has never been a road so dark in Jungkook's life, each steps heavier, each stop of the night train raising anxiety, but the fury was pushing him forward. Empty like a ghost town, was the posh neighborhood he entered like a shadow walking up a hill along huge fences of villas, billionaires and celebrities were hiding in. His hands trembling when he stopped at the crossing looking towards Hoseok's hose and the still lit up window of his bedroom while sending out a text.

'I'm on my way to yours, need to talk, will be there in five.'

He wondered if Hoseok has received his message as he never replied. A car with darkened windows passed by so Jungkook rushed through the street towards the gate placing his gloved hand on the board pressing the code Jimin had given him, as Hoseok's house had been a good place for secret meetings.

The lock sounded, so Jungkook pushed the gate rushing inside, closing his palm on the knife, it needed to be done swiftly and precisely even though he has never done anything like that, but Hoseok deserved death, for what he has done he deserved a painful death.
